What is Recovery Mode on Honor and why do you need it?

Mode Recovery Mode (or โ€œrecovery modeโ€) is a separate micro-OS built into the smartphone Honor at the firmware level. It starts before the main system boots and allows you to:

  • ๐Ÿ”„ Reset settings to factory settings (Wipe data/factory reset) - deletes all data, including accounts, applications and files in the internal memory.
  • ๐Ÿ“ฆ Install updates manually (via Apply update from ADB or SD-card).
  • ๐Ÿ”ง Clear cache (Wipe cache partition) - helps with lags and errors without data loss.
  • ๐Ÿ› ๏ธ Restore system via eRecovery (proprietary tool Huawei/Honor to download firmware over the air).
  • ๐Ÿ”“ Unlock bootloader (required for installing custom firmware, but may void the warranty).

On new models Honor (for example, Magic 6 Pro or Honor 200) the recovery mode can be replaced with Fastboot with limited functionality due to the security policy Huawei. In such cases, a full recovery will require a connection to a PC.

โš ๏ธ Attention: Resetting through recovery deletes all data, including photos, messages and applications. If the phone still turns on, first make a backup via HiSuite or cloud Huawei Cloud.

How to enter Recovery Mode on Honor: all methods

The method of entering recovery depends on the model Honor and firmware version. Below are the current combinations for devices 2020โ€“2026.

Method 1: Through buttons (for most models)

This method works on Honor 8X, Honor 10, Honor 20, Honor 50 and other devices with physical buttons:

  1. Turn off the smartphone (if it freezes, hold the power button for 10-15 seconds).
  2. Hold the combination:
    • For older models (before 2020): Volume Up + Power.
    • For new ones (2021โ€“2026): Volume Up + Power (hold until vibration, then release Powerbut continue to hold Volume Up).
  • When the logo Honor or EMUIappears, release the buttons. After 5-10 seconds, the recovery menu will open.
  • On some devices. (for example, Honor Magic 4) instead of the standard recovery, it may open Fastboot with the inscription "Phone Locked". In this case, you will need to unlock the bootloader.

    Method 2: Via ADB (if the phone turns on)

    If the smartphone works, but you need to enter recovery to clear the cache or install an update, use ADB (Android Debug Bridge):

    1. Enable USB debugging in settings: Settings โ†’ About phone โ†’ Build number (press 7 times), then return to Settings โ†’ System โ†’ For developers โ†’ USB debugging.
    2. Connect your phone to the PC, install ADB drivers and open the command line in the folder c platform-tools.
    3. Enter the command:
      adb reboot recovery
    โš ๏ธ Attention: On models Honor c MagicOS 7.0+ (2023โ€“2026), USB debugging may be possible is blocked by default. To activate it, you will need to enter your account password Huawei ID.

    Method 3: Through HiSuite (official method)

    If the phone does not respond to buttons, but is detected by the PC, use the proprietary utility HiSuite:

    1. Download and install HiSuite on the computer.
    2. Connect Honor to the PC via USB (preferably original cable).
    3. V HiSuite select System recovery โ†’ Recovery in Recovery mode.
    4. This method is safer than manual entry, since the utility will automatically select the recovery version for your model.

      Instructions for resetting settings via Recovery

      Resetting to factory settings (Hard Reset) - the most radical but effective way bring Honor to life. The procedure deletes all data, including:

      • ๐Ÿ“ฑ Applications and their data.
      • ๐Ÿ‘ค Google, Huawei, social network accounts.
      • ๐Ÿ“ธ Photos, videos and music (if they are stored in the internal memory).
      • ๐Ÿ“ž Call and SMS logs.

    To reset:

    1. Log in Recovery Mode (see section above).
    2. Use the volume buttons to navigate and the power button to select an item.
    3. Select Wipe data/factory reset โ†’ Yes.
    4. Once completed, return to the main menu and select Reboot system now.

    On models Honor Magic 5/6 i Honor 200 s MagicOS 7.2+ reset via recovery may require entering a password from Huawei ID, even if the phone was not linked to the account before. This is a theft protection measure.

    Recovery via eRecovery: downloading firmware over the air

    eRecovery is a proprietary tool Huawei/Honorthat allows you to download and install official firmware directly from recovery mode. This is useful if:

    • ๐Ÿ”„ The phone does not turn on after an unsuccessful update.
    • ๐ŸŒ The system is very slow due to damaged files.
    • ๐Ÿ“ฑ You need to return the stock firmware after the custom one.

    Instructions:

    1. Login Recovery Mode.
    2. Select Download latest version and recovery (or a similar item, depending on the model).
    3. Connect to Wi-Fi (press Wi-Fi and enter password).
    4. Wait for the firmware to download (may take 10-30 minutes).
    5. After installation, the phone will reboot automatically.
    โš ๏ธ Attention: On models Honor s MagicOS 7.0+ function eRecovery may be blocked if the device was unlocked via Fastboot. In this case, you can restore the firmware only through HiSuite.

    If eRecovery gives an error "Network error" or "Server unavailable", check:

    • ๐ŸŒ Wi-Fi connection (it is better to use 5 GHz).
    • โณ Time and date on the phone (if they are wrong, correct them manually in recovery).
    • ๐Ÿ”Œ Battery charge (should be >50%).
    What to do if eRecovery freezes at 0%?

    This is a typical problem for models Honor with a damaged partition /cache. Solution:

    1. Return to the main recovery menu.

    2. Select Wipe cache partition โ†’ Yes.

    3. Try booting again via eRecovery.

    If it doesnโ€™t help, flash the phone via HiSuite or Fastboot.

    Typical errors in Recovery Mode and their solutions

    When working with recovery on Honor users often encounter errors. Here are the most common ones and how to fix them:

    Error Cause Solution
    No command (robot with exclamation mark) Damaged recovery or incompatible firmware. Hold Power + Volume Up 10 seconds to open the menu.
    E:Can't mount /cache The cache partition is damaged. Execute Wipe cache partition, then reboot.
    Error: 7 When installing ZIP Incompatible firmware or damaged file. Check the firmware version and download the file again.
    Your device is corrupted The bootloader has crashed or the system is damaged. Flash the phone via Fastboot or HiSuite.

    If after manipulations in recovery the phone stops turning on or freezes on the logo, try:

    1. Run forced reboot (hold Power + Volume Down 20 seconds).
    2. Flash the device via HiSuite v mode Force Update.
    3. Contact the service center (if the warranty is valid).
